While singer-songwriter Mark Mulcahy would go on to make a name all of his own, his career actually started with Miracle Legion; one of the original ‘college rock’ bands who formed in 1983 and became something of a cult hit following acclaim from the likes of NME and Melody Maker and the release of their debut album on Rough Trade Records.Almost two decades since their last full-length release “Portrait of A Damaged Family”, the band back together on UK shores this summer.
Miracle Legion immediately sprang to life on the heels of a post-R.E.M. guitar rock boom in the 80s. The Connecticut-based band (lead by Mark Mulcahy) took to the scene and rode high from even their first release:The Backyard EP, which was released by the small Incas Records label in 1984. It was an immediate college hit with a string of album releases coming out on the legendary Rough Trade records.
“Gifted singer and a unique sound that still holds up more than two decades later. ” – Consequence of Sound
Support:
Andy Halliday’s New Mistake
Described as: “an upbeat blues pop jangle of indie urgency”, Andy Halliday’s simple songs are meant as personal odes to the often-overlooked basic elements of modern living. This is Andy’s solo outing, as you can usually catch him as part of the popular Brighton trio Flash Bang Band. Expect his live performance to include improvisation and a re-imagining of his existing recorded material.
